Planning Your Outdoor Transformation
Start by defining the main purpose of your outdoor space. Is it meant for relaxing with a book, hosting weekend gatherings, or enjoying family dinners outside? Once you know the goal, you can choose elements—such as comfortable seating, lighting, and plants—that fit your vision perfectly.
Incorporating natural features adds harmony and warmth. Using a mix of greenery, flowers, and shrubs creates color and texture, while stone pathways guide movement and add structure. Water features like fountains or ponds can introduce soothing sounds, making the space more inviting.
Layering is a design technique that works wonders—placing tall plants or structures in the back, medium-height elements in the middle, and smaller pieces in front gives depth and visual appeal. This approach makes even a small yard feel more expansive.
When selecting materials for furniture and decor, prioritize quality and durability. Weather-resistant fabrics, treated wood, and rust-proof metals ensure your space stays beautiful over time. Adding eco-friendly elements also supports sustainability while giving your area a modern, responsible touch.
Finally, consider how lighting transforms your space after dark. String lights, solar lamps, and LED fixtures can create a cozy, welcoming atmosphere.
